Output 20510869d5cd4c053c0fbf92ec5a6687bd8490982fc16654bf59bde3712bc5cf:24

value
3474933
script pubkey
OP_0 OP_PUSHBYTES_32 c7fde871cbad5aa54d1ad9741c74c535c981a29cbb66c9d219303acb163acda5
address
bc1qcl77suwt44d22ng6m96pcax9xhycrg5uhdnvn5sexqavk936ekjsxyjjvk
transaction
20510869d5cd4c053c0fbf92ec5a6687bd8490982fc16654bf59bde3712bc5cf
spent
true